SHILLONG: After the huge success of its first ever marathon, the annual fest of IIM Shillong (Khlur-Thma 2014) was kicked off on Friday.

Khlur-Thma which means ‘war of stars’ in Khasi language, was conceived as a Case Study Competition by the Shillong Lajong Football Club from which it has evolved into the annual B-School Fest of IIM Shillong.

With the theme of ‘Strike to Survive’, IIM Shillong took this year’s fest a notch higher by increasing the gamut of competitions. It featured events like Touchstone, the Marketing Case Study Challenge; decipHR, the HR Case Study Challenge and Vishleshan, the Finance Case Study Challenge sponsored by RBI and Corporate Bridge.

Khlur-Thma will conclude on October 11 with Shrinkhala, the Operations Case Study Challenge.

Also, the seventh season of the IIM Shillong Golf Cup is all set to tee off on 11th October 2014 and will feature corporates and students from various B-Schools in the country.
